Toshiba releases high-speed quad-channel digital isolators, the DCL54xx01 Series, that feature 100kV/μs (min) of high common mode transient immunity (CMTI) and a 150Mbps high-speed data rate. The products ensure the safety and reliability of factory automation equipment and prevent noise propagation. The new products leverage Toshiba’s exclusive magnetic coupling type insulated transmission method to provide a high CMTI of 100kV/μs (min).

Toshiba has provided photocouplers and isolation devices to its customers through optical coupling for 50 years. Now the company plans to line up high-speed quad-channel digital isolators that support real-time data transmission required for industrial equipment control.
